Large BOHO (FAT LAVA) ceramic lamp with original fabric shade – 1960s/70s. BRUTALIST.



Description

Very large vintage ceramic lamp from the 60s–70s, executed in a distinctive BOHO / mid-century style.

The lamp has a bulb-shaped ceramic foot with geometric relief and a characteristic speckled glaze in earth tones (brown, beige, and black). The glaze exhibits a beautiful light sheen, especially visible when light hits it.
The lamp is complete with the original, matching cylindrical fabric shade and forms a single unit; this is not a later assembled lamp.

The lamp is equipped with a capsule switch marked KUPP, indicating original electrification from the period.

Based on style, form, and glaze, this lamp can likely be attributed to the West German ceramic tradition, in the style of Bay / Scheurich / Dümler & Breiden (no maker's mark present, therefore no definitive attribution).

Due to its royal dimensions, this is a true statement lamp, suitable as a large table lamp or low floor lamp. Very decorative within a BOHO, eclectic, or mid-century interior.


Condition

Good vintage condition

Ceramic foot intact, no cracks or restorations.

Case with light signs of use and aging appropriate for its age.

electric

Dimensions

Ceramic base: height 51 cm, diameter 29 cm.

Lampshade: height 82 cm, diameter 39 cm (bottom) / 35 cm (top).

Total height: approximately 133 cm
